The Take-Out Wedge is a Modular Outdoor Seating System

The Take-Out Wedge was designed by Rodrigo Torres for Landscape Forms as part of the Take-Out collection, a modular range of outdoor seating and tables for public spaces. The wedge-shaped unit introduces an angled seating arrangement that positions users between side-by-side and face-to-face interaction, encouraging informal conversation while maintaining a shared outward view.

The collection also includes single, double, triple, wheelchair-accessible, tall, and children's configurations that can be used individually or combined to create adaptable layouts. Powder-coated metal components, extruded aluminum supports, and nylon glides provide durability for outdoor environments.

The seating system can be arranged into linear rows, curved configurations, radial clusters, and enclosed gathering spaces to suit plazas, campuses, workplaces, and hospitality settings. Color-matched connector brackets secure adjoining units for permanent installations, while optional tabletops with umbrella openings expand the system's functionality.
